Empire of Nicaea: John III Ducas-Vatazes (1222-1254) Æ Trachy, Magnesia (Sear 2091; DOC IV, Type C.37; Lianta 224-25)
|
Obv: MP - ΘV in upper field. Full-length figure of Virgin nimbate; holds beardless, nimbate head of Christ on breast. Large cross on either side in field.
Rev: O/ΔϪ/KA/C; IC XC in upper and right field. Full-length figure of emperor on left, crowned by Christ, bearded and nimbate. Emperor wears stemma, divitision and paneled chlamys; right hand holds labarum-headed scepter; left hand holds anexikakia. Christ holds Gospel in left hand.
Dim: 30mm, 4.20g
